The Commercial Loan Servicing Agent is a full-time position that requires knowledge of the loan process. This role serves as a critical liaison between the financial institution and its commercial clients, ensuring the effective administration, monitoring, and servicing of commercial loan portfolios.

Essential Functions
- Maintain Weekly Reports such as note exceptions, past due and ticklers
- Maintain Monthly Reports such as Uniform Commercial Code (UCC) Expiring Report, Participation Transaction Report
- Renew County and State Uniform Commercial Codes (UCCs) every 5 years
- Prepare Satisfaction of Mortgages, Satisfaction of Assignment of Rents
- Release liens on car titles / Uniform Commercial Codes (UCCs)
- Work with Loan Agents and Lenders on all Commercial Partial Releases of property
- Process loan payoffs (checks / wires)
- Prepare payoff quotes
- Send Paid Notes to customer
- Complete all Commercial Loan Maintenance in Core
- Complete all Participation Payment Wires
